Care Manager - Dementia Specialist

Healthcare$38.46–$41.03/hrFull-time

About the Organization

Jewish Family and Children's Services (JFCS) has served the San Francisco Bay Area for 175 years. We offer world-class services to support individuals and families across all stages of life, including adoption, mental health, senior care, disability services, financial assistance, Holocaust education, and youth development. Our mission and work are rooted in Jewish values, and we serve people of all faiths and backgrounds. Seniors At Home provides a wide range of services to help older adults live safe, healthy, and independent lives, including home care, personal assistant services, companionship, and specialized dementia and palliative care. We provide the Bay Area’s leading continuum of care for aging adults.

About the Role

Jewish Family and Children's Services (JFCS) is seeking a compassionate and experienced Care Manager - Dementia Specialist to join our Center for Dementia Care. This temporary position (duration of assignment is to be determined) provides an opportunity to support individuals living with dementia and their families through comprehensive assessments, care planning, education, and ongoing care management while contributing to one of the Bay Area's leading nonprofit organizations.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ct comprehensive dementia assessments and develop individualized care plans
  • Provide care management and ongoing support to clients and family caregivers
  • Educate and coach families and caregivers using evidence-based dementia care practices
  • Collaborate with physicians, community providers, and interdisciplinary team members to coordinate services
  • Train caregivers in effective communication techniques and non-pharmacological dementia interventions
  • Assist with dementia-related education and training for agency staff
  • Make appropriate community referrals and connect clients with supportive resources
  • Participate in outreach activities that promote dementia education and JFCS services
  • Maintain accurate documentation and ensure high-quality client care

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ree required; Master's degree in Social Work, Gerontology, Nursing, or a related field preferred
  • Minimum three (3) years of professional experience working with individuals living with dementia and their families
  • Strong interpersonal, assessment, and communication skills
  • Ability to work independently while collaborating effectively with an interdisciplinary team
  • Valid California driver's license, reliable vehicle, and ability to travel throughout the Bay Area

Benefits

  • Cafeteria benefits plan that lets you customize coverage to fit your needs, with options like health insurance, FSAs, retirement plans, and wellness programs
  • Employer 403(b) retirement match plus additional employer contribution (subject to eligibility)
  • 16 holidays annually (10 federal and up to 6 Jewish holidays)
  • 3 weeks of vacation and 2 weeks of sick leave annually

Pay

Pay Range: $38.46 - $41.03/hr (depending on experience)

Schedule

Temporary full-time, non-exempt position with benefits
